Check Their Qualifications
It is essential to select a commercial gas engineer who is qualified and experienced. This will help to ensure that your business is running smoothly, but it will also give you peace of mind knowing that the work is completed safely and with high quality. One way to do this is by asking the potential candidate for references from past clients. These references can provide an insight into their character and degree of professionalism. It is also important to determine whether they're registered with the Gas Safe Register. If they are, then you can be assured that they've been trained to safely install, inspect and repair commercial gas equipment.
It is important to confirm the qualifications of some candidates. You can do this by looking at their Gas Safe ID card, which will contain a photo with an expiry date and a list of jobs they're qualified for. You can ask them to provide you with a copy of the certificates and qualifications they hold.
In addition to checking their credentials, you should also ask about the kinds of services they provide and what kind of equipment they specialize in. Some commercial gas engineers might only work on heating systems for homes, whereas others may have more experience working on industrial systems. While the majority of gas engineers offer the same services, a few may specialize in particular areas. It could be that they are more knowledgeable about certain systems or appliances or prefer to focus on a specific kind of work. Some engineers repair boilers only, while others install new boilers.

Additionally, some companies may charge more for certain services, like emergency or after-hours services. This is usually due to the fact that these services require more advanced skills or require additional labor and materials. Some engineers include travel costs but others don't.
A quote from a gas engineer can be an excellent way to find out how much the service will cost. It's important to remember that some businesses may not include all fees when they give you an estimate. For instance, some might not include the cost of components or labor when they give a quote over the phone, so make sure to inquire about the exact amount you're paying for before hiring them.
